I am nit picking, but at the 10:00 mark you raised the throttle before engaging the powereverser which put needless wear on the clutch and saved zero time. Engage the powereverser at idle, then raise the throttle...takes the same amount of time with the least clutch wear. Granted there are situations where you need to engage motion with above idle rpm, but 99% of the time you don't.

Question: if the clutch stops the tractor why do I need to break? Would I be able to clutch and shift?
@WesternEquipment
2 ай бұрын
The clutch only puts the tractor in neutral, so on flat ground the tractor would naturally come to a stop but if you were on a hill it would continue to roll. And yes, you can clutch and shift.
